Plane spotting at BZZ

RAF Brize Norton, Carterton, Oxfordshire

RAF Brize Norton (BZZ) is the largest air base in the UK and is fascinating for spotters due to its military operations and diverse aircraft. Identify and collect aircraft with FlightCatcherPro.

By the numbers

RAF Brize Norton has two main runways and serves as a hub for military transport operations.
